探秘宁晋H5小程序高级研发,为你揭开实现之路!

作者:信阳麻将开发公司 阅读:18 次 发布时间:2024-04-30 00:05:17

摘要:本文探讨了宁晋H5小程序高级研发的实现之路。首先介绍了H5小程序的基本概念和优势,接着讲述了宁晋H5小程序的开发环境和基础知识,然后分析了H5小程序的性能优化和安全防范,最后分享了几个值得注意的开发技巧。通过本文的学习,读者可以全面了解宁晋H5小程序的高级研发实现之路,并掌握相应的技术要点和开发...

  本文探讨了宁晋H5小程序高级研发的实现之路。首先介绍了H5小程序的基本概念和优势,接着讲述了宁晋H5小程序的开发环境和基础知识,然后分析了H5小程序的性能优化和安全防范,最后分享了几个值得注意的开发技巧。通过本文的学习,读者可以全面了解宁晋H5小程序的高级研发实现之路,并掌握相应的技术要点和开发技巧。

探秘宁晋H5小程序高级研发,为你揭开实现之路!

  1. H5小程序的基本概念和优势

  H5小程序是基于HTML5技术实现的一种轻量级、跨平台的应用。相比于传统的原生APP,H5小程序具有现代化的设计风格、更快的开发速度、更好的跨平台兼容性和更低的维护成本。另外,H5小程序通过微信开放平台和支付宝开放平台等综合入口进行发布和推广,可以获得更广泛的用户群体。因此,越来越多的企业和开发者开始关注和投入到H5小程序的研发和推广中。

  2. 宁晋H5小程序的开发环境和基础知识

  宁晋H5小程序的开发环境需要安装微信开发者工具和支付宝小程序开发者工具,并且需要注册微信开放平台和支付宝开放平台的开发者账号。开发语言主要是HTML、CSS和JavaScript,另外还需要掌握微信API和支付宝API等相关技术。为了提高开发效率和代码质量,可以使用各种开发工具和框架,例如Vue.js、React.js、mpvue等,以及第三方组件库和插件,例如WeUI、vant等。同时,还需要了解小程序的生命周期和事件处理等基础知识。

  3. H5小程序的性能优化和安全防范

  为了保证H5小程序的流畅度和稳定性,需要进行性能优化。具体来说,可以采取减少页面嵌套、使用图片懒加载、合并压缩代码、减小代码体积、使用文件缓存等多种优化手段。此外,为了保证用户数据和资产安全,还需要进行安全防范。例如,需要对用户输入进行严格的校验和过滤,防止XSS和SQL注入等攻击,以及加密用户敏感数据和使用HTTPS协议等保障交互安全。

  4. 值得注意的开发技巧

  在H5小程序的开发过程中,有些开发技巧是值得注意的。例如,应该避免使用全局变量和全局导入等不规范的编程方式,而应该采用模块化和组件化的开发方式,以及尽量避免使用CSS样式选择器中的通配符和ID选择器等性能较低的选择器。另外,还可以使用小程序的API和JavaScript的`localStorage`和`sessionStorage`等存储方式,对用户数据进行持久化存储和管理。同时,还可以合理利用小程序的云开发功能,对后台服务进行扩展和优化。

  5. 结束语

  总之,宁晋H5小程序的高级研发实现之路需要掌握多种技术要点和开发技巧。在实践过程中,需要不断总结和归纳,不断优化和升级。只有将理论和实践结合起来,才能打造出更加优秀的H5小程序,满足用户需求和提升企业价值。

  本文将带你深入探秘宁晋H5小程序高级研发,从实现路线的角度来详细介绍H5小程序的开发步骤和流程。文章包含5个大段落,分别介绍H5小程序的概述和优势、开发环境的搭建、主要实现技术、数据接口及调试方法、以及部署上线的流程。通过阅读本文,你将能够全面了解H5小程序的研发知识,实现自己的小程序项目。

  1. H5小程序的概述和优势

  H5小程序是一种类似于微信小程序的Web应用程序,它具有与微信小程序相似的体验和功能,但是相比微信小程序,H5小程序更具优势,主要体现在以下几个方面:

  1)H5小程序无需下载,可以直接通过浏览器访问,用户体验更加自由便捷;

  2)H5小程序在设备兼容性方面更加广泛,几乎可以覆盖所有移动设备和平台;

  3)H5小程序支持HTML5特性,能够更好地调用设备硬件资源,实现更多的功能;

  4)H5小程序具有更强的可扩展性和定制性,开发成本更低,推广和营销更加灵活自由。

  2. 开发环境的搭建

  要进行H5小程序的开发,首先需要搭建相应的开发环境。推荐使用Vue.js框架来进行开发,搭建开发环境具体步骤如下:

  1)在本地安装Node.js和npm包管理工具;

  2)安装Vue.js脚手架,命令行输入如下指令:

  npm install -g vue-cli

  3)创建项目,在命令行输入如下指令:

  vue init webpack my-project

  4)进入项目目录,安装依赖,命令行输入如下指令:

  cd my-project

  npm install

  5)启动本地服务器,进行项目调试,命令行输入如下指令:

  npm run dev

  3. 主要实现技术

  H5小程序的实现技术主要有以下几点:

  1)HTML5和CSS3:H5小程序使用HTML5和CSS3来实现页面布局和样式设置,包括响应式布局、动画效果、图标制作等等;

  2)JavaScript:H5小程序使用JavaScript语言实现交互逻辑和数据处理功能,包括数据请求、状态切换、表单验证等等;

  3)Vue.js框架:H5小程序使用Vue.js框架来进行组件化开发和数据绑定,包括组件的拆分和复用、状态管理和事件监听等等;

  4)Webpack和Babel:H5小程序使用Webpack和Babel来进行代码打包和转换,包括资源的压缩和优化、ES6和ES7的转换等等。

  4. 数据接口及调试方法

  H5小程序需要通过HTTP请求来获取数据接口,一般可以使用Axios库或者Fetch API来实现。同时,为了方便调试和开发,我们需要使用Chrome浏览器中的开发者工具来进行调试和查看,主要包括以下几个方面:

  1)Network面板:用来查看HTTP请求和响应的状态码、请求头和响应体等信息;

  2)Console面板:用来输出调试信息和打印变量值等信息;

  3)Sources面板:用来查看网站的资源文件和JavaScript代码;

  4)Elements面板:用来查看网页的HTML结构和CSS样式。

  5. 部署上线的流程

  H5小程序开发完成后,需要进行部署和上线。一般来说,我们需要将代码上传到Github、码云等源代码管理平台上进行版本控制,再将代码部署到云服务器上搭建的Web环境中,最终通过域名访问,实现小程序的上线和推广,具体流程如下:

  1)在源代码管理平台上创建项目,将代码上传至平台;

  2)准备云服务器和域名等资源,安装Web环境,包括Nginx、PHP、MySQL等服务,并将代码部署到服务器上;

  3)配置域名解析,将域名解析到服务器的IP地址上,以便访问小程序;

  4)备案和安全证书申请,确保小程序顺利上线并保证数据和用户的安全。

  H5小程序作为当前Web开发的热点技术之一,具有很强的应用前景和市场潜力,同时也是一个学习和探索的好机会。通过本文的介绍,相信大家已经对H5小程序的开发有了深入了解,并能够轻松实现自己的小程序项目。同时,也欢迎更多的IT从业者加入到H5小程序的开发行列中来,共同推动Web技术的发展和进步。

  • 原标题:探秘宁晋H5小程序高级研发,为你揭开实现之路!

  • 本文由信阳麻将开发公司网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与物智科技网联系删除。
  • 微信二维码

    CTAPP999

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员

    点击这里给我发消息电话客服专员

    在线咨询

    免费通话


    24h咨询☎️:166-2096-5058


    🔺🔺 24小时客服热线电话 🔺🔺

    免费通话
    返回顶部